Ingredients
Ingredients
For the Stir Fry
- 1 lb ground beef
- 2 cups mixed bell peppers, sliced
- 1 cup broccoli florets
- 1 cup carrots, sliced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on sesame oil
- 1 teaspoon ginger, minced
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Cooked rice or noodles for serving

Instructions
Instructions
Cook the Beef
In a large skillet over medium-high heat, add the ground beef. Cook until browned and crumbled, about 5 minutes. Drain excess fat if necessary.
Add Vegetables
Add the sliced bell peppers, broccoli, and carrots to the skillet. Stir-fry for about 3-4 minutes until the vegetables are tender-crisp.
Flavor it Up
Add the minced garlic, ginger, soy sauce, and sesame oil. Stir well and cook for another 2 minutes until everything is heated through.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
Serve
Serve the stir fry over cooked rice or noodles. Enjoy!
Don't forget to garnish with sesame seeds or green onions if desired!

Storage and Reheating
If you have leftovers from your Ground Beef and Veggie Stir Fry, you can store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. This makes it a fantastic option for meal prep, allowing you to enjoy a delicious home-cooked meal on busy days. Just be sure to let it cool before transferring it to the container to minimize moisture buildup.
When it comes to reheating, the stovetop is your best friend. Simply add a splash of water or broth to a skillet to prevent sticking and reheat over medium heat until warmed through. This method helps retain the texture of the vegetables, ensuring you enjoy a meal that's just as tasty as when it was first cooked.

Questions About Recipes
→ Can I use a different type of meat?
Yes, you can substitute ground turkey, chicken, or even tofu for a vegetarian option.
→ How can I store leftovers?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
→ Can I freeze this dish?
Yes, you can freeze the stir fry for up to 2 months. Just reheat thoroughly before serving.
→ What other vegetables can I add?
Feel free to add or substitute your favorite vegetables like snap peas, zucchini, or mushrooms.

Nutritional Breakdown (Per Serving)
- Calories: 350 kcal
- Total Fat: 20g
- Saturated Fat: 8g
- Cholesterol: 70mg
- Sodium: 600mg
- Total Carbohydrates: 20g
- Dietary Fiber: 3g
- Sugars: 5g
- Protein: 25g
